In a surprising turn, Emilia Clarke has announced her departure from the fantasy genre following her iconic role in “Game of Thrones.” After years of portraying Daenerys Targaryen, a character that became synonymous with her identity as an actress, Clarke is eager to embrace new challenges and explore different types of storytelling. This decision marks a pivotal moment in her career, as she seeks to redefine herself beyond the realm of dragons and epic battles.
A New Chapter for Clarke 🌟
In a recent interview, Clarke revealed that her time in the fantasy realm has been both rewarding and exhausting. “Game of Thrones” was a monumental experience, but it also made her realize the need for change. The series, which aired from 2011 to 2019, was not just a cultural phenomenon; it was a grueling journey that required immense emotional and physical investment. Clarke expressed a desire to delve into more diverse roles that showcase her range as an actress.
Clarke’s portrayal of Daenerys not only catapulted her to stardom but also left a lasting impact on her career. The character’s complexity and evolution throughout the series allowed Clarke to showcase her talent in ways few roles can. From a vulnerable young woman to a powerful queen, her journey was fraught with challenges that mirrored the tumultuous nature of the show itself. However, she acknowledges that it’s time to move forward. “I want to challenge myself in different genres,” she stated, emphasizing her eagerness to step outside the fantasy box.

The Impact of “Game of Thrones” on Clarke’s Career
“Game of Thrones” was not just a show; it was a cultural milestone that reshaped television. The series garnered a staggering 59 Primetime Emmy Awards and was watched by millions worldwide, making it one of the most successful series in HBO’s history. For Clarke, the role of Daenerys was a double-edged sword. While it brought her fame and recognition, it also typecast her in the fantasy genre, leading to the very decision she now embraces.
